#2f7736 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f7736 is composed of 18.4% red, 46.7%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.6%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 125.8 degrees, a saturation of 43.4% and a lightness of 32.5%. #2f7736 color hex could be obtained by blending #5eee6c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#2f7736 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#2f7736 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f7736 has RGB values of R:47, G:119,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 3110710.

Shades and Tints of #2f7736
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030703 is the darkest color, while #f7fcf8 is the lightest one.
